Rare DrKoob Posted September 12, 2008 #2 Share Posted September 12, 2008 We did the canal in an aft cabin (9162) in 2004. Have had five aft cabins on Infinity since then. The best was the canal. Being able to sit on our verandah during the transit of the canal was OUTSTANDING. We got to see it all without standing in the huge crowd on the top deck. And as warm as the weather is, you really use the verandah and that makes it part of your room. I would definitely go for the aft if you can get it.
